Crowds gathered outside a New York courthouse on Thursday where Venezuelan President Nicolás Maduro was making a court appearance. The gathering drew a mixture of supporters and demonstrators expressing their opinions on the Venezuelan leader’s legal proceedings.

Several protesters were seen holding banners calling for Maduro’s release, with messages such as “Free Pres. Nicolás Maduro and Cilia Flores Now!” Some of the demonstrators appeared to be affiliated with the Marxist-Leninist Workers World Party (WWP), an organization known for its leftist political stance. The presence of such groups suggests a political dimension to the protests, reflecting ongoing global divisions over Maduro’s leadership.

Authorities maintained a visible security presence around the courthouse, while bystanders watched the procession and demonstrations unfold. The specific reasons for Maduro’s appearance in court were not detailed, but the event drew media attention due to the high-profile political figure involved and the presence of organized protest groups.

Maduro’s legal proceedings and the protests highlight continued international interest and controversy surrounding his presidency and Venezuela’s political situation.
